 A food that is a staple of my family would be open faced sandwiches. It was a great depression food that has been passed down through our family. It is beans cheese and bacon on a hamburger bun. My dad has always said that the meal keeps us humble and reminds us of how lucky we are. This meal has been in my family for almost 100 years. It is important to my culture because it shows the southern pride in our food.
